Understanding What Prodex Really Does
Prodex CR is a Costa Rican manufacturer specializing in thermal insulation, acoustic materials, and protective foam solutions. These products are used in residential buildings, commercial structures, agricultural operations, and packaging for sensitive items like electronics. The core idea is simple, control temperature, reduce unwanted sound, and protect valuable products from damage.
Their materials are designed for tropical climates, where heat and humidity can quickly become problems. This makes Prodex especially relevant for local construction and agriculture, where imported solutions often fail to adapt to real conditions on the ground.
Thermal Insulation That Works in Hot Climates
One of the strongest areas of Prodex is thermal insulation. Heat buildup inside buildings is more than a comfort issue, it affects energy use, productivity, and long term building maintenance.
Common uses of Prodex thermal insulation include:
- Roofing systems for homes and warehouses
- Wall insulation for residential and commercial buildings
- Industrial facilities where temperature stability matters
- Agricultural structures such as storage areas and workspaces
By limiting heat transfer, Prodex insulation helps keep indoor spaces cooler during the day. This reduces the need for constant air conditioning, which can noticeably lower energy costs over time. In areas where electricity prices fluctuate, that matters.

Protective Foam Packaging for Real Protection
Prodex is also known for protective foam packaging. These solutions are designed to absorb impact, prevent scratches, and stabilize products during transport or storage.
Typical applications include:
- Electronics packaging
- Agricultural product protection
- Industrial components and tools
- Custom packaging for fragile or irregular items
Instead of one size fits all solutions, Prodex foam products are designed to match specific protection needs. This is especially important for export oriented businesses, where damaged goods can mean lost contracts or reputational harm.
